In this episode, John talks with John Ray about how our mindset about money, value, and ourselves shapes our business. They also discuss why pricing your expertise is so hard, how to deal with imposter syndrome, and why confidence must come before clarity. About John Ray: After a successful career in investment banking, investment management, and strategic advisory, John Ray left the corporate world in 2013 to build his own business. It didn't take long to find the gap nobody had prepared him for: he routinely undervalued his own expertise, struggled to set prices that matched the outcomes he delivered, and watched his clients do the exact same thing. He spent the next several years figuring out how to fix it for himself first, then for the consultants, coaches, attorneys, CPAs, fractional executives, and other expert practitioners who hire him today to gain clarity, confidence, and profitability through positioning, pricing, and value-based business development. That work became his first book, The Generosity Mindset: A Journey to Business Success by Raising Your Confidence, Value, and Prices (2023). His second book is set for release in the first quarter of 2027.
